WebFeb 22, 2024 · You define an Iterator for your DynamicArray, but if the array is modified while your iterator is in flight over the list, odd things may happen. For example: If you … WebDynamic arrays arraylists tutorial example explainedPart 1 (00:00:00) theoryPart 2 (00:05:00) practice#dynamic #arrays #arraylists
Dynamic Array Data Structure Interview Cake
WebIf the size of the array is allocated to be 10, we can not insert more than 10 items. However, the dynamic array adjusts it’s size automatically when needed. That means we can store as many items as we want without … WebA dynamic array is an array with a big improvement: automatic resizing. One limitation of arrays is that they're fixed size, meaning you need to specify the number of elements your array will hold ahead of time. A dynamic array expands as you add more elements. So you don't need to determine the size ahead of time. sick live wallpapers for pc
Dynamic array - Wikipedia
WebMay 9, 2024 · In this HackerRank Dynamic Array problem, we need to develop a program in which we need to perform the queries using the bitwise operations. Problem solution in Python programming. a = input().split(' ') N, Q = [int(e) for e in a] arrays = [[] for _ in range(N)] lastans = 0 def insert(x, y): global lastans arrays[(x ^ lastans) % N].append(y ... WebFeb 13, 2013 · 5 Answers. Sorted by: 1. Array is static because you create it with size. For dynamic, use ArrayList. ArrayList is a Array too. ArrayList has default size of 10 and growth 25% (total size) when reaching 75% total size. But it's slow because of when ArrayList reach 75%size, java will create a new Array and copy data to new one in memory. The dynamic array is a variable sizelist data structure. It grows automatically when we try to insert an element if there is no more space left for the new element. It allows us to add and remove elements. It allocates memory at run time using the heap. It can change its size during run time. In Java, ArrayListis a resizable … See more In the dynamic array, the elements are stored contiguously from the starting of the array and the remaining space remains unused. We can add the elements until the reserved spaced is … See more The initialization of a dynamic array creates a fixed-size array. In the following figure, the array implementation has 10 indices. We have added five elements to the array. Now, the underlying array has a length of five. … See more In Java, the dynamic array has three key features:Add element, delete an element, and resize an array. See more The initialization of the dynamic array is the same as the static array. Consider the following Java program that initializes a dynamic array. … See more sick litter of puppies